The latest report from the Mental Health and Wellbeing Commission paints a concerning picture of the mental health landscape for young people in New Zealand. The findings reveal that nearly a quarter of young individuals are grappling with high levels of psychological distress, a figure that has more than doubled in the last decade. This trend is particularly alarming, as it highlights the growing mental health crisis among the youth, with Māori, Pacific peoples, young people, and disabled individuals bearing the brunt of this burden. The data also underscores the stark disparity in access to specialist services, with a significant decline in referrals and a widening gap in unmet needs for Māori. The commission's chief executive, Karen Orsborn, attributes this distress to the challenging world young people inhabit, including online harm and the global environment. The report further highlights the alarming rates of intentional self-harm requiring hospitalisation among young people, nearly three times the overall average. The use of seclusion, or solitary confinement, in mental health facilities remains a critical issue, with Māori being disproportionately affected. Despite government efforts to minimise its use, the number of people subjected to seclusion is still unacceptably high. The Mental Health Bill, currently before Parliament, aims to further reduce the use of seclusion, particularly for individuals under 18 years of age. The bill is seen as a crucial step towards addressing the issue, with the national director for mental health and addictions, Phil Grady, acknowledging the progress made since 2009 but recognising the ongoing challenges. The report's recommendations include the development of a national seclusion plan and the inclusion of specific data collection for high-needs populations. Minister for Mental Health Matt Doocey acknowledges the progress made in improving access to support and the mental health workforce, but emphasises the need for continued efforts to address the unique challenges faced by young people.
